Before we dive into the methods, let’s talk about legality. Some websites allow downloads, while others explicitly prohibit them due to copyright laws. You should only download videos for personal use or when you have permission from the content owner.

For tech-savvy users, browser developer tools can help download videos directly from the page source.
Step 1. Open the website and play the video.
Step 2. Right-click and select "Inspect" (or press F12).
Step 3. Go to the "Network" tab and filter for "Media".
Step 4. Find the video URL, right-click, and open it in a new tab.
Step 5. Right-click the video and select "Save As".

1. Can I download YouTube videos?
YouTube’s terms prohibit downloading videos without permission unless you use YouTube Premium.
2. What is the best tool to download videos from a website?
It depends on your needs. EasySaveVideo is easy for saving videos to cloud accounts, 4K Video Downloader is great for high-quality downloads, and SaveFrom.net works well for quick, free downloads.
3. Can I download videos on my phone?
Yes! Android users can use Videoder, while iPhone users can try Documents by Readdle.
4. Why can't I download a video from a website?
The site might have protection against downloading, or your browser extension may not support it. Try another method.
5. Is it legal to download videos from websites?
It depends. If the website allows downloads or you have permission, it’s fine. Otherwise, it may violate copyright laws.
